Installation Instructions

8

7.

Slowly guide hooks on top of interface brackets on top of
wall plate in desired mounting location. (See Figure 5)

8.

Slowly swing display toward wall. (See Figure 5)

Figure 5

9.

Rotate flags on each interface bracket down to the closed
position in order to lock brackets to wall plate. (See Figure
6)

Figure 6

NOTE:

Flags should stay in locked position unless removing

display from wall bracket.

NOTE:

Display should be held in full vertical position by spring
clips on uprights. For some larger displays, a second
spring clip (DD) may be required in order to hold the

display in the full vertical position. See "Extra Spring
Clip Installation" Section for details.

Tilt Adjustment

1.

Display may be tilted forward by pulling forward on the top
of the display as desired. (See Figure 7)

Figure 7

2.

Tilt tension is adjustable by using 3/16" hex key (AA) in the
tension adjustment nut. (See Figure 7)

NOTE:

Tension should be adjusted equally on each bracket to
ensure even tension distribution.

NOTE:

Due to the low profile of the Thinstall Series, certain

displays may have limited tilt capabilities.

3.

To return display to full vertical position, push display back
against wall until spring clips secure display in vertical
position.
